Patch's Poll: Do You Use Your Vacation Days?

About 57% of working Americans had unused vacation time at the end of 2011 - does that sound familiar? Take our poll and add your thoughts in the comments.

We are coming up on Memorial Day weekend, which is the unofficial start to summer. Summer is the time when most folks plan and take their vacations from work. But a recent study shows that many American workers don't use most of their allocated time off.

"About 57% of working Americans had unused vacation time at the end of 2011, and most of them left an average of 11 days on the table - or nearly 70 percent of their allotted time off, according to a study performed by Harris Interactive for JetBlue."

Among reasons workers gave for forgoing vacation were:

  • Felt they could not take the time
  • Could not afford to travel
  • Were worried about taking time off in an unstable job market.
